#05c270 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#05c270 is composed of 2% red, 76.1%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.3%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 154 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 39%. #05c270 color hex could be obtained by blending #0affe0 with #008500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#05c270 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#05c270 has RGB values of R:5, G:194,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 377456.

Shades and Tints of #05c270
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000302 is the darkest color, while #effff8 is the lightest one.
